onsite
Staff Full Stack Software Engineer - Orbit Platform - Boston Dynamics
Software Engineer
Senior full‑stack engineer driving core features for the Orbit robotics platform, integrating cloud‑scale services, multi‑robot fleet management, and intelligent agentic applications using Python, C++, React and cloud infrastructure.
About the role
Key Responsibilities
- Design and implement end‑to‑end features for the Orbit platform, including fleet orchestration, agentic application support, and lifecycle management.
- Collaborate with product managers and robotics software teams (Spot, Atlas, Stretch) to translate requirements into high‑quality, maintainable code.
- Develop and maintain cloud‑native services on AWS, leveraging Kubernetes for scaling and reliability.
- Build responsive front‑end interfaces using React and TypeScript to provide operators with real‑time insights and control.
- Ensure robust CI/CD pipelines, automated testing, and performance monitoring across the full stack.
Requirements
- 10+ years of software engineering experience with strong expertise in both backend (Python, C++) and frontend (React, TypeScript) development.
- Proven experience designing, deploying, and operating cloud‑native systems on AWS and Kubernetes.
- Deep understanding of robotics software ecosystems, real‑time data processing, and multi‑robot coordination.
- Track record of delivering large‑scale, high‑availability services with automated testing and CI/CD best practices.
- Excellent problem‑solving skills and ability to work cross‑functionally in a fast‑paced, innovative environment.
Skills
pythoncreacttypescriptkubernetesaws